A Welcoming City: Resources, strategies, and challenges to aid refugee and immigrant families with integration

Join VTC Unfinished for a discussion of the obstacles that refugee and immigrant families face once they enter the United States, as well as the community efforts in place to help overcome these obstacles. Topics covered will include unique healthcare needs, educational resources, community and organizational support, and federal and state policies that facilitate this process. Special attention will be dedicated to the perspective of the family, the challenges faced, and the ways in which the medical community can better serve this growing population.
